## Session Handling for Health Checks

The Corvel gateway sits behind the Lanternside load balancer, which probes /healthz every ten seconds. Health-check requests are stateless by design: they bypass the session store entirely so that probe traffic never inflates session counts or evicts real user sessions. New team members should note that the deep-check endpoint, /healthz/deep, does verify session-store connectivity and therefore requires authentication. When probing it manually, supply the token below.

bearer token for tajep-kajef: eyJhbGciOiJIUzI1NiIsInR5cCI6IkpXVCJ9.eyJzdWIiOiIoOsZ23In0.CsygO0hs

**Onboarding: ParityScope releases**

You cut ParityScope releases weekly from the `stable` branch. Rate-parity scan configs live in the Lanternfall vault; never edit them in prod directly. First release, you'll need to unseal the signing store once — after that it stays warm. The unseal passphrase is below.

vault phrase of hahop-badug = novvan-ulaion-zorius-noviel-gorwyn-casix-tamys

## Deployment

The Lumacache image service has a known slow leak in its thumbnail cache layer: evicted entries keep a reference alive through the decoder pool, so resident memory creeps up roughly 40 MB per hour under steady load. Until the refactor in the Harkness branch lands, we mitigate by capping pool size and scheduling a rolling restart every 12 hours. Deploy with the supervisor, never bare, or the restart hook won't fire. The deployment relies on the configuration values listed below.

settings of bagug-tahof:
holath:
  pin: 7837
  metrics_host: metrics.holath.tolvaqsys.internal
  tenant: quenath
  seal: seal_6001b3af

### Tailing logs with `snoopctl`

Support staff use `snoopctl`, the internal CLI, to tail production logs without shell access. Install it from the Hartvale package mirror, then create `~/.snoopctl.env`. Set `SNOOP_CLUSTER=prod-east` and `SNOOP_BUFFER_LINES=500`. The CLI refuses to stream anything until it can authenticate against the log gateway, which requires a personal access credential placed on the line directly below the buffer setting.

env line for bagap-yajep: COURIER_KEY20=b4db4e5e33a646898766